A few issues:
1) Text is default.
2) Some mobs have default texture e.g villager magma cube.
3) Mojang logo is default.
I am using the 128x version.
Yes I have used MC patcher.
Text is default because I can't be bothered to make one :biggrin.gif: (Sorry to be blunt about that)
Honestly it's because mcpatcher and optifine do them both differently. So no matter which way I make it, it will always look wrong on one of them. So I'm just not going to bother until they sort themselves out.
Villagers will remain to have the default texture because they're characters.
The player has a 16x skin. It's only fitting that villagers have 16x too. Otherwise the player will look completely out of place.
I am however going to be editing them to look like wastelanders.
Mojang logo? Really?
No. Why waste my time on something that lasts for a second and has no effect on gameplay. Perhaps one day. When I have time.

I like the look of the texture pack. Looking forward to checking it out. I wanted to get a good wasteland map to go with it. Which one is in the video? Just learning how to do all this stuff so go easy on me
I like the look of the texture pack. Looking forward to checking it out. I wanted to get a good wasteland map to go with it. Which one is in the video? Just learning how to do all this stuff so go easy on me
It's not a map you download. It's actually new world generation code.
It's done by installing the "Wasteland Mod" by Silver Weasel.
Beware. It's not updated to 1.2.3 yet as of this message.
So you will need to install it onto a 1.1 Minecraft.jar
If you don't have one or didn't back it up. Shame :/
If you do have a 1.1 jar but don't know how to install it.
Drop me a message.
